About this experience

Spring and fall is a fantastic time for sightseeing and viewing wildlife in Banff National Park. Foliage colour start to change, the first hints of winter begin to appear and a low sun makes photographic opportunities more dramatic. Come and discover beautiful Lake Louise at its very best! Listed as a UNESCO World Heritage site, there will be plenty of photo opportunities on this half day, small-group tour. Learn about the mountaineering history and how a tragic accident shaped Canadian mountain culture.

What you'll see and do

  1. Lake Louise

    Spend around an hour at Lake Louise and take a stroll on the lake shore. See the famous Fairmont Chateau Lake Louise.

    60 minutes here

  2. Bow Valley Parkway

    Take the scenic road to Lake Louise, with a sightseeing stop along the way. This wildlife-rich habitat is great for spotting animals.

  3. Fairmont Chateau Lake Louise

    See the famous Chateau hotel during your visit to Lake Louise.
